HEART GAME: REQUIEM (run 1)
You awaken in the ☆ZRAEL dorm common room. It’s dark. Darker than usual, and the reason why is immediately apparent: the lamps are all extinguished, the stars have disappeared, and the moon has shifted to new. The ocean below the glass panes of the floor is silent and still. Everything feels cold and unmoving, not unlike a painting.

CITY REMAINS
But you continue to the edge of the forest and abruptly stumble into the burned-out remains of a city. Skyscrapers are crumbling, but the bombs haven’t touched this place in a long time, by the looks of it. Plant life is starting to grow and garbage and pieces of machinery have been abandoned where they lay.
